Message type: E = Error
Message class: /TMF/ECF -
Message number: 028
Message text: Job canceled successfully

- Job canceled successfully ?The SAP error message
/TMF/ECF028 Job canceled successfully
typically indicates that a job in the SAP system was canceled, but it was done so in a way that the system recognizes it as a successful cancellation. This message is often related to the SAP Transport Management System (TMS) or other job scheduling processes.Possible Causes:
- Manual Cancellation: A user or administrator may have manually canceled the job.
- Job Dependencies: The job may have been dependent on another job that failed or was canceled, leading to its cancellation.
- System Configuration: There may be configuration settings in the job scheduling or transport management that dictate how jobs are handled upon certain conditions.
- Resource Issues: The job may have been canceled due to resource constraints, such as memory or processing power.
- Timeouts: The job may have exceeded its allowed execution time and was canceled as a result.
Solutions:
- Check Job Logs: Review the job logs to understand why the job was canceled. Look for any preceding error messages or warnings.
- Review Dependencies: Ensure that all dependent jobs have completed successfully. If a dependent job failed, resolve that issue first.
- Re-run the Job: If the cancellation was not intentional, you can try to re-run the job.
- Adjust Job Settings: If the job is frequently canceled due to timeouts or resource issues, consider adjusting its settings, such as increasing the timeout limit or allocating more resources.
- Consult Documentation: Refer to SAP documentation or support notes related to the specific job or process you are working with for additional guidance.
- Contact SAP Support: If the issue persists and you cannot determine the cause, consider reaching out to SAP support for assistance.
